Naomi was discharged with a prescription for the antidepressant Zoloft, but she stopped taking it after a few weeks, because it made her tired and she didn’t believe it would work. Drugs will not “change the heartache in the world,” she had told her psychiatrist. To be her true self, Naomi felt, required suffering in the face of a racist and violent reality.
